Before they were enemies, the US and Iran used to have a thing. In fact, we started their nuclear program.

Like any failed relationship… it’s not just one thing that led us all here. Years of misinformation, politics, greed, reality tv, and some real security interests on both sides brought us to this point.

This is the story of how the US and Iran broke up — because you can’t truly understand the Iran deal without first understanding why the US and Iran have bad blood.

Laicie Heeley is the founding CEO of Inkstick Media, where she serves as Editor in Chief of the foreign policy magazine Inkstick and Executive Producer and Host of the PRX- and Inkstick-produced podcast, Things That Go Boom. Heeley’s reporting has appeared on public radio stations across America and the BBC, where she’s explored global security issues including domestic terrorism, disinformation, nuclear weapons, and climate change. Prior to launching Inkstick, Heeley was a Fellow with the Stimson Center’s Budgeting for Foreign Affairs and Defense program and Policy Director at the Center for Arms Control and Non-Proliferation. Her publications include work on sanctions, diplomacy, and nuclear arms control and nonproliferation, along with the first full accounting of US counterterrorism spending after 9/11.
